Nineteen HIV-Positive People in China Win Compensation From Hospital After Contracting Virus From Unscreened Blood

A group of 19 HIV-positive people in Northeast China's Heilongjiang Province will receive about $2.5 million from the hospital where they contracted the virus after receiving transfusions of unscreened, illegal blood, a court ruled on Tuesday,... Read more »
